Technology Blog Posts by SAP
cancel
Showing results for 
Search instead for 
Did you mean: 
adarsh_hegde
Product and Topic Expert
Product and Topic Expert
14,851

What is Edge Integration Cell?

Edge Integration Cell (EIC), part of the SAP Integration Suite, brings a powerful hybrid integration runtime that bridges the gap between the cloud and your private landscape. It provides the flexibility to seamlessly manage APIs and run integration scenarios within a controlled environment, combining the best of both worlds.

With its hybrid deployment model, EIC makes it easy to design and monitor integration content in the cloud, while still allowing it to be securely deployed and run in a customer managed private environment.

 

Use cases and Advantages of EIC

  • Security or compliance use cases: Sensitive data stays safely within an enterprise's firewall, following strict rules to keep it within a private environment.
  • Migration path for SAP Process Integration customers: EIC helps customers design and monitor integration content in the cloud, while keeping deployment and execution fully within their private environments.

This blog offers a step-by-step guide to deploying Edge Integration Cell on AWS, with two setup options: a quick setup for trying out the simplest setup and a high-availability configuration for production. Whether you're looking for a quick test or a scalable, production-ready deployment, this guide makes it easy to configure SAP BTP and AWS resources. Once the setup is complete, the SAP Integration Suite can deploy integration flows securely to on-premise setup using EIC. 

 

Architecture

Both the quick setup and the high availability (HA) setup architecture for deploying EIC on AWS utilize Amazon Elastic Kubernetes Service (EKS). The quick setup uses the default Virtual Private Cloud (VPC) in the region, with all storage handled by Amazon Elastic Block Store (EBS) and smaller compute and storage resources for a simple and efficient deployment. In contrast, the HA architecture is spread across at least three availability zones for redundancy, with dynamic storage managed by a combination of EBS and Amazon Elastic File System (EFS), along with additional services like Amazon Relational Database Service (RDS) for persistence and Redis for caching.

On the SAP BTP side, the Edge Integration Cell must be activated within the SAP Integration Suite. Once the EIC is configured and successfully deployed on the AWS EKS cluster, integration flows can be designed and seamlessly deployed to the new EIC runtime, combining the powerful integration capabilities of SAP Integration Suite with the customer managed resources on AWS.

sap-edge-integration-cell-aws-new copy.png

 

Edge Integration Cell setup overview on SAP BTP and AWS

Here is an outline of the steps involved in setting up and deploying Edge Integration Cell from SAP BTP environment to AWS.

Setup on AWS:

EIC_process_AWS.drawio.png

 

Setup on SAP BTP: 

EIC_process_SAP.drawio.png

 

You can find the detailed setup instructions in the following GitHub repository – Deploy SAP Integration Suite - Edge Integration Cell on Amazon Web Services.

 

Additional resources

Here are some helpful resources related to Edge Integration Cell:

 

Conclusion

I hope this blog has helped you set up Edge Integration Cell on AWS, making it easier to connect SAP on-premise solutions with the flexibility to design and monitor integrations in the cloud. By following these steps, you can build secure, high-performing business applications that blend innovation with control in a safe environment.

I want to express my gratitude to our SAP team members, Weikun Liu, Sangeetha Krishnamoorthy, Dante Alipio Jr., and Sivakumar N for their valuable contributions, guidance, and support. If you have any questions, feel free to contact paa@sap.com.

 

4 Comments